When should appeals be submitted to reasonably ensure they will meet a scheduled special selection board?

0

If submitted under the provisions of AFI 36-2401 via an AF Form 948, they must arrive at AFPC no later than 90 days prior to the board start date. Or, if submitted under the provisions of AFI 36-2603, they must arrive at AFPC no later than 120 days prior to the board start date for processing at the AFPC level. If your appeal is disapproved at the AFPC level, an advisory will be submitted, along with your Department of Defense Form 149 , Page 1 and Page 2 appeal package, to the Air Force Board for Correction of Military Records at Andrews Air Force Base, Md. The AFBCMR will make the final determination on your case (please note the AFBCMR has up to 10 months to finalize your case at their level).
